The area of a rectangular parking lot is 8051 m ^2 . If the length of the parking lot is 97 m, what is its width?
Answer:
Width of rectangle = 83 meter
Step-by-step explanation:
Given:
Area of rectangle = 8,051 m²
Length of rectangle = 97 m
Find:
Width of rectangle
Computation:
Area of rectangle = Length of rectangle x Width of rectangle
97 x Width of rectangle = 8,051
Width of rectangle = 8,051 / 97
Width of rectangle = 83 meter

Rename 5/6 and 14/15 using the least common denominator.
Answer:
25/30 and 28/30
Step-by-step explanation:
1. To find the least common denominator, you need to find the least common multiple of the two denominators which are 6 and 15. Prime factorization of these numbers gives:
6 = 2 x 3
15 = 5 x 3
A number that would evenly divide both 6 and 15 must contain 2 x 3 x 5 which is 30.
Thus 30 is the least common denominator.
2. Now we need to somehow change both fractions to make them have a denominator of 30. To do this we can multiply by fractions with same numerator and denominator since that would be like multiplying by 1.
So, 5/6 x 5/5 = 25/30
And 14/15 x 2/2 = 28/30
